Post by yuugure on Aug 6, 2008 20:21:17 GMT -5
Too young? Katara's the one younger than Sokka. I'd say the reason Katara feels it more and Sokka feels it less is because for the past seven or however many years since Kya was murdered, Katara's had to replace essentially take over her mother's role in the family, bringing much needed stability. Sokka benefited from her stepping up, and was able to move on some, but Katara being forced to "grow up" kept her from doing the same.

Aug 6, 2008 20:37:19 GMT -5
Post by asian malaysian on Aug 6, 2008 20:37:19 GMT -5
^^ Well theyre only a year a part and boys are said to mature more slowly than girls. Still, fair point. I think another reason Katara is more bitter about it could be sub-conscious guilt. I think part of Katara felt that if she had run faster for Hakoda or done something differently that day, Kya might not have died. Of course no one would ever blame Katara for what happened but its not so hard to imagine her feeling responsible since she was the last family member to see her mother alive.
